What to buy for people who like beer?

For the person who appreciates a cold beer, there are many great gifts that can be bought. From beer glasses to beer tastings, there’s something for everyone who loves a good IPA or lager.

For starters, a beer glass set makes a great gift. There are different glasses for different types of beer, like pilsners, goblets, and mugs. Beer geeks might appreciate a nice set of rare glasses from limited-edition releases.

Next, beer gift sets are a great choice for the beer connoisseur. These sets come with several types of beer and often feature unique flavors, like an IPA flight and craft beer sampler. For the barbecue fans, there are also beer can chicken racks that make it easy to serve beer-infused poultry.

For those who like to brew their own beer, there are homebrewing kits and starter sets. These sets include everything they’ll need to get started, such as beer kits, bottles, and yeast. If beer brewing is already their hobby, you can get them individual ingredients, like malt extract and yeast, or a fancy gadget to up their brewing game.

Finally, a beer tasting or beer tour makes a great gift. Many breweries offer beer tastings that show the person some of the best beers in the city. Beer tours, on the other hand, take the beer lover through a brewery and teach them all about the brewing process.

There are also smaller beer tastings and tours that visit multiple breweries in one day.

What snacks go with beer?

Snacks that go well with beer include salty, crunchy snacks like pretzels, peanuts and chips, as well as bite-sized items like sliders and tacos. You can also combine beer with tantalizing bar snacks that pair nicely with the refreshing malt flavor of beer.

These can include homemade dips, onion rings, fried cheese curds, pickles, fried ravioli, calzones, stuffed mushrooms, stuffed jalapenos, mac and cheese bites and mozzarella sticks. Nuts, roasted peanuts and even popcorn all work great when sipping on a brew.

Cheese and crackers are also great snack options to accompany beer, as are smoked and jerky meats, which tend to have a more complex, smoky flavor. If you’d like to add a touch of sweet, you can’t go wrong with small desserts like cookies, cupcakes and random pieces of fruit.

What generation drinks the most craft beer?

From the most recent survey data, it appears that the Millennials (born between 1981-1997) are the biggest drinkers of craft beer. The survey found that 70% of craft beer drinkers are people aged between 21 and 38, with the majority of craft beer drinkers being between 21 and 34.

This age range fits neatly within the Millennial category, making them the most avid craft beer drinkers. Some analysts attribute this trend to Millennials’ fondness for indulging in experiences, such as beer festivals, live music events, traveling, and of course, trying interesting craft beer.

Additionally, Millennials view craft beer as a status symbol and are willing to pay more for a higher-end product. Finally, Millennials often seek out craft beers for their variety, flavor and the story behind the beer.

Combined, these factors make craft beer an ideal product for Millennials and have made them the biggest generation of craft beer drinkers.

What is so special about craft beer?

The brewing process of craft beer is often more time-consuming and intricate than that of mass-produced beer. This allows for a greater degree of control over the final product, ensuring that each batch of craft beer is of a consistently high quality.

The ingredients used in craft beer are also generally of a higher quality than those used in mass-produced beer, as the breweries that produce craft beer take care to source the best possible ingredients.

In addition to the higher quality of the beer itself, craft beer is also often seen as being more interesting and flavorful than mass-produced beer. This is because craft breweries often experiment with different flavor profiles and ingredients, resulting in a more diverse range of beers.

For example, a craft brewery might produce a beer that is infused with citrus flavors, while another might produce a beer that is brewed with smoked malt.

Finally, many people enjoy craft beer because it is produced by small, independent breweries. These breweries often have a strong connection to their local communities, and their beers can be seen as a reflection of the local culture.

For instance, a craft brewery in New England might produce a beer that is made with locally-grown hops, and a craft brewery in California might produce a beer that is made with locally-grown fruits.
